Output d581ff58a60d6b0bb20434488306335acdcf60d8ca6376ca0d55358e304246ab:4

value
596345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0159bd3e7913c78f38b88c6a6b2c838d3981478b OP_EQUAL
address
31pA6viNbhrQpPkhyUeUVB4r28urHwhqvy
transaction
d581ff58a60d6b0bb20434488306335acdcf60d8ca6376ca0d55358e304246ab
spent
true